About WPP Media

WPP is the trusted growth partner for the world’s leading brands. With exceptional talent, trusted data and intelligence, and world-class partnerships – all united by our pioneering agentic marketing platform, WPP Open – we help clients navigate change, capture opportunity, and deliver transformational growth.

WPP Media is WPP's AI-driven media operating unit, bringing together media, data, and partnerships to deliver creative personalisation at scale. Connected through WPP Open and powered by Open Intelligence, clients see exactly where, how, and why their media investment is working.

The UK is the largest market within the WPP Media EMEA region, with over 4,500 people employed within the WPP Media ecosystem. Marquee UK key clients include Amazon, UK Government, BT, Tesco, Coca Cola, Bayer, Dell, Unilever, M&S, Ford, Nestle, Mazda, Danone and Colgate.

Role Summary

As the Business Director for First Party Systems, you will lead the delivery and operational management of WPP Media’s first-party systems domain, with a primary focus on WPP Open and Open Media Studio. Reporting to the VP, Systems, you will translate the agreed systems strategy into an executable delivery plan for the first-party portfolio and ensure its successful implementation across the business.

This senior leadership role is responsible for driving the adoption, rollout, and continuous improvement of the first-party ecosystem, including client workspace enablement, Open Media Studio systems transformation, and the migration from legacy systems into Campaign Management 2.0.
